Weather in January

January, the same as December, in Tyrnävä, Finland, is a freezing cold winter month, with temperature in the range of an average high of -6.1°C (21°F) and an average low of -10.6°C (12.9°F).

Temperature

January, with its average high-temperature of -6.1°C (21°F) and an average low-temperature of -10.6°C (12.9°F), holds the record as the coldest month.

Humidity

January and February, with an average relative humidity of 95%, are the most humid months in Tyrnävä.

Rainfall

In Tyrnävä, Finland, during January, the rain falls for 4.9 days and regularly aggregates up to 37mm (1.46") of precipitation. Throughout the year, in Tyrnävä, there are 117.3 rainfall days, and 434mm (17.09") of precipitation is accumulated.

Snowfall

Months with snowfall are January through May, September through December. In Tyrnävä, Finland, during January, snow falls for 21.4 days and regularly aggregates up to 209mm (8.23") of snow. Throughout the year, there are 107.1 snowfall days, and 1131mm (44.53") of snow is accumulated.

Daylight

The average length of the day in January is 5h and 19min.
On the first day of January, sunrise is at 10:19 and sunset at 14:21.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 09:07 and sunset at 15:54 EET.

Sunshine

In January, the average sunshine is 1.5h.

UV index

January through March, November and December, with an average maximum UV index of 1, are months with the lowest UV index. A UV Index estimate of 2, and below, represents a minimal health hazard from unsafe exposure to UV radiation for the ordinary person.
Note: A maximum high UV index of 1 in January translates into the following recommendations:
Despite most people tolerating extended sun exposure, it is critical to always protect those with sensitive skin, infants, and children. The solar radiation is most powerful near the mid-day, so the exposure to the direct Sun should be reduced accordingly. On bright days sunglasses that block both UVA and UVB rays should be worn. A hat with a wide brim is extremely helpful, as it can prevent roughly 50% of UV radiation from reaching the eyes. Note well! The intensity of the Sun's UV rays can be nearly doubled by snow reflection.
